Bombs and Banalities

Bombs and Banalities

3 March 2026 /Posted byNick Moss
Post Views: 289

By Nick Moss

The war against Iran will be waged with
Bombs and banalities.
Operation Lion’s War
Turns “Women, Life, Freedom”
Into 150 dead in a bombed-out girls’ school in Minab,
And those who brought you Kermit’s coup
In 1953 tell you to throw off your shackles
In the name of liberty, while Hegseth
Tells the press pack
This is not a democracy-building exercise;
They are not killing you
To set you free.

Tomahawk cruise missiles, B2 stealth-bombers,
Anthropic targeting, and banalities about
Liberation. All hail Operation Epic Fury.
Freedom reduced to the freedom to see
SAVAK replaced by the Revolutionary Guard Corps
And the basij, to then be replaced by goons
Hand-picked by Mossad and the CIA
So that the promise of ’79, of the oil strikes
And shoras becomes the liberty to choose
Whose bullets will cut down the crowds
In the street.

Still, it should run well in the mid-terms,
Thinks Princeton Pete, the Christian Zionist
Opponent of theocracy who promises
“We won’t waste time or lives”
But means we won’t waste our own.
And Queen’s County Donald‘s
Fat orange neck is turning Virginia red;
Pallagra from the burger diet
Or the fish rotting from its head?

Their plan is to keep us backward, to keep us in our present miserable state so they can exploit our riches, our underground wealth, our lands, and our human resources. They want us to remain afflicted and wretched, and our poor to be trapped in their misery. – Islamic Government: Ayatullah Ruhullah al-Musawi al-Khomeini (1970)
